Review of Never Rarely Sometimes Always (2020) by A.a. Dowd for The A.V. Club — 26 Jan 2020
Hittman isn’t really a polemicist. She expresses her empathy and political conscience through a refined version of what’s become her signature style, zeroing in on details of place and behavior, both magnified by the reliably involving scenario of two kids from the sticks navigating the hustle, bustle, and bright lights of the city.
And moments of startling, unaffected tenderness peak through the grimness of the circumstances.
